This article analyzes the cover of one of the Estado de Minas
newspaper editions and, in doing so, intends to investigate the effects of the
sense constructed by rereading the journalistic literature mode, commonly
associated with the first pages of printed newspapers, taken here as covers. As
an example, the cover published in November 2015, whose main characteristic
is a graphic composition radically different from the traditional model adopted
by the largest newspapers, the intertextual and interdiscursive play established
with the lyrics of the song Que país é esse? by Legião Urbana. Using
the theoretical-methodological contribution of discursive semiotics, especially
with regard to studies on syncretism in verbal-visual texts, we notice that
the mobilization of certain enunciative strategies, associated to changes in
the plastic composition in texts of this nature, create unlikely simulacra for
journalistic discourse. Regarding the edition under analysis, we highlight the
effects of literature, interdisciplinary relations and intertextual allusions that
reconfigure the way newspapers are published and how content is presented
to the enunciatee-reader.
